Restoring Vspeed defaults:
1) From PFW Home, touch Speed Bugs.
2) Touch the Restore All Defaults Button. Vspeeds are restored to default values and all
Vspeed buttons are disabled.
Or:
1) From MFW Home, touch PERF > Speed Bugs.
2) Touch the Restore All Defaults Button. Vspeeds are restored to default values and all
Vspeed buttons are disabled.
ALTIMETER
Selecting the Altitude/Vertical Speed Display Units:
1) From MFW Home, touch Utilities > Setup > Avionics Settings.
2) Touch the Units Tab.
3) Scroll and touch the Altitude/Vertical Speed Button.
4) Touch either the Feet (FT, FPM) Button or the Meters (MT, MPS) Button.
5) When finished, touch the Back Button or the Home Button.
Setting the Selected Altitude:
1) Turn the ALT Knob on the AFCS Controller to update the Selected Altitude in 100-ft
increments. Quickly turning the ALT Knob will change the selected altitude in larger
increments.
2) If set, the Minimum Descent Altitude/Decision Height (MDA/DH) value is also available for
the Selected altitude.
3) Push the ALT Knob to synchronize the selected altitude with the displayed altitude to the
nearest 10 ft.
Enabling/Disabling Meters Overlays on the Altimeter:
1) From PFW Home, touch PFD Settings.
2) Scroll and touch the Meters Overlay Button to enable (green annunciation).
Or:
1) Press the PFD Settings Softkey
2) Press the Other PFD Settings Softkey
3) Press the Altitude Units Softkey
4) Press the Meters Softkey to display the meters overlay. Press again to disable the
overlay.
5) When finished, touch the Back Button.
